Ninhydrin reacts with a mMonia and primary and secondary amines producing a blue or purple reaction product (diketohydrindylidene-diketohydrindamine). Co mMonly used for the development of fingermarks on porous surfaces. Also useful in the analysis of free amino groups in proteins, peptides and amino acids. May be useful for detecting ninhydrin-reactive nitrogens in soil for forensic applications.
